Crystal structure of ferritin soaked with iron from Pseudo-nitzschia multiseries
X-RAY DIFFRACTION
Crystallization
Crystalization Experiments | ||||
---|---|---|---|---|
ID | Method | pH | Temperature | Details |
1 | VAPOR DIFFUSION, HANGING DROP | 5.5 | 293 | Crystals grown in 0.1 M ammonium acetate pH 5.5 and 1.6 M ammonium sulphate then soaked in 20 mM ferrous sulphate, 2 mM sodium sulphate and 25% glycerol for 10 minutes, VAPOR DIFFUSION, HANGING DROP, temperature 293K |
